Ethiopian new year celebration. The ethiopian new year enkutatash means the gift of jewels. The ethiopian new year is a celebration involving the entire family. It occurs on meskerem 1 on the ethiopian calendar which is 11 september or during a leap year 12 september according to the gregorian calendar.

The holiday starts on new year s eve when each household light wooden torches called chibo in amharic language that symbolise the coming of the new season of sunshine after the end of the rainy season that has prevailed since june.
